Connectors
Connectors are devices that connects two active devices to transmit current or signals. Connectors are an indispensable part of an electronic device. Depending on the application, frequency, power and the environment of the application a variation of types of connectors can be used.
Engineering technicians use one or more connectors to bridge the communication between blocked or isolated circuits in the circuit, so that current flows. This component makes sure that the circuit achieves the intended function. Connectors can be divided into many types; circular, rectangular and square connectors. Depending on the connection the connectors can be divided into board to board connectors, wire to board connectors etc.
